The new (wrong) formula looks like this =SUM((C14+(C15*H2))*1.3).

Cells C14 and C15 are empty. Cursor over the “C” in the formula and change that to a “B” so it reads =SUM((B14+(B15*H2))*1.3) instead.

Now the math works.

So in our example, the Keystone Price for a 7-color print for quantities of 144-299 is $2.57 for the decoration. Remember, this is added to the marked up shirt cost. To fill out all the other colors, just repeat the steps above. Google Sheets will replace the “B” in our pasted formula with the column the cell is in. You just need to edit it back.
